USATT Sanctioned 2-Star Table Tennis Tournament with $2,400 in Cash Prizes!
Friday, October 2 – Sunday, October 4, 2020

What You Can Expect

  • Spin & Smash will be fully disinfected daily
  • Clean, disinfected Butterfly A40+ balls will be used for each match
  • New masks will be given daily to each player.  Hand sanitizer will be available throughout the facility
  • Staff will be healthy and will get temps checked on arrival and wash hands frequently

What We Ask of Participants

  1. All players must change their shoes in the lobby area immediately upon entering the facility.
  2. All players must sign the health waiver daily (parents sign for minors).
  3. All players must get a daily temperature check at the facility entrance.
  4. All players must social distance 6’ apart and not change sides of the table.
  5. All players 10 and older must wear masks at all times off the table when staying indoors.  Outdoor seating will be available.  Masks are not required when outdoors and more than 6’ distancing is used.
  6. All players must refrain from physical touch (Handshakes and Fist Pumps).
  7. All players are encouraged to bring their own water bottle or purchase water from the pro shop. Our drinking fountain is closed indefinitely.
  8. No entry for those with a fever above 100.4, COVID-19 symptoms,    recent contact with a COVID-19 patient, or anyone with a compromised immune system or chronic illness.
  9. It is recommended that persons more vulnerable or at-risk for COVID-19 as  identified by the CDC-including those who are over the age of 65 or those who have chronic medical conditions-take extra precaution or refrain from use of the facility
  10. Occupancy limit is 40. Please limit spectators to parents or coaches.
  11. Bring your own ball to warm up.
  12. Disinfect the table after each match – supplies are available at each table.
